In Math, please review concepts we have worked on this year: counting orally 
1-100, writing numbers and counting objects 1-10, shapes, patterns, and 
ordinal numbers 1st-10th. This week, we will introduce a chapter on time. You 
can practice telling time with your child to the hour and half-hour.
